Adverse effects of interferon on the cardiovascular system in patients with chronic hepatitis C

Abstract:
The therapeutic effects of interferon in chronic hepatitis C and many of its adverse effects have been well documented. However, there are only a few reports regarding its adverse effects on the cardiovascular system. The aim of this study was to clarify the clinical features of the adverse effects of interferon on the cardiovascular system in patients with chronic hepatitis C. We monitored 295 patients with chronic active hepatitis C during 312 courses of interferon therapy and for 1 year after the end of treatment for the presence of cardiovascular adverse effects. We found 6 patients with cardiovascular adverse effects during interferon therapy and 4 more patients within 1 year after the end of therapy (10/312, 3.2%). The adverse effects of interferon on the cardiovascular system included arrhythmia (n = 4), ischemic heart disease (n = 4) and myocardial disease (n = 2). None of the clinical factors, including history of cardiovascular disease, were related to these cardiovascular adverse effects. In all instances the patient's condition improved after discontinuation of interferon and adequate therapy. The cardiovascular adverse effects of interferon occurred frequently in patients with chronic hepatitis C, even after the end of therapy and they were unpredictable. Thus, all patients undergoing interferon therapy should be monitored not only during but also after the end of treatment.
